College Station, Texas – The Texas A&M baseball team, currently holding an overall record of 27 wins and 20 losses, is gearing up for a crucial three-game series against Missouri this weekend. With a Southeastern Conference (SEC) record of 10 wins and 14 losses, the Aggies face the tough task of securing their postseason status amidst an uncertain season.

After the cancellation of their midweek game against Houston, Texas A&M looks to build on their recent momentum. The team achieved a significant series victory last weekend against the No. 3 rated LSU, where they demonstrated impressive resilience by winning two out of three games. This triumph not only boosted the team’s confidence but also put them in a favorable position as they aim to solidify their spot in the NCAA Tournament, where they are currently viewed as a “bubble team,” making their postseason potential clouded.

As the Aggies prepare for their matchups against Missouri, they are set to take the field with a few standout players leading the charge. Terrence Kiel II is currently the team leader in batting average, boasting a solid .316 at the plate. Jace LaViolette has been a power hitter, leading the team with 15 home runs and an impressive 53 runs batted in (RBI). On the pitching side, Ryan Prager leads the staff with an earned run average (ERA) of 3.76, while teammate Justin Lamkin has amassed a striking 75 strikeouts this season.

The series against Missouri presents Texas A&M with a vital opportunity to enhance their chances for the NCAA Tournament. The matchups for the weekend are scheduled as follows: Friday at 6:00 p.m. CST featuring Brady Kehlenbrink (0-4, 8.58 ERA) for Missouri against Ryan Prager (3-3, 3.76 ERA) for Texas A&M. On Saturday at 2:00 p.m. CST, Sam Horn (0-1, 9.00 ERA) will take on Justin Lamkin (3-6, 3.88 ERA), while the series closes on Sunday at 1:00 p.m. CST with Wil Libbert (2-3, 6.33 ERA) facing Myles Patton (3-3, 4.95 ERA). All three games of the series will be broadcast on SEC Network Plus.

In stark contrast, Missouri enters this series struggling significantly, holding a record of just 13 wins and 35 losses, with a dismal 0-24 mark in SEC play. The team is currently experiencing a 12-game losing streak, making them a challenging opponent for Texas A&M in terms of both morale and competitiveness. Despite Missouri’s struggles, baseball experts suggest that the Aggies are the more talented team, amplifying the importance of this series for Texas A&M as they strive to improve their postseason profile.

The Aggies, who were initially predicted to secure the SEC title in the preseason poll, have had a turbulent season. Now, with only a few series left in the regular season, each game will be pivotal as they look to turn their fortunes around and solidify their place in the postseason. The upcoming series against Missouri is not only crucial for their record, but for the overall momentum heading into the final stretch of the season.
